Is Overwatch 2 blurry?

Fixes for blurry screen issues in Overwatch 2
The number one culprit of the blurry screen issue is the Dynamic Render Scale. If it is set to on, then Overwatch 2 will adjust its in-game resolution on the go to keep up with the desired frame rate (at default, it is at 60 FPS).

Is Overwatch 2 graphics intensive?

Overwatch 2 isn't that graphically demanding. The graphical requirements for the game haven't increased much compared to Overwatch 1 which ran on an Intel Core i3 or equivalent. The RAM requirement for the game has gone up slightly from 4 GB to 6 GB.

Why do games still use motion blur?

Motion blur can be one of the most important effects to add to games, especially racing games, because it increases realism and a sense of speed. Motion blur also helps smooth out a game's appearance, especially for games that render at 30 frames per second or less.

Does motion blur reduce FPS?

Motion blur is a graphical effect that blurs the image as objects move quickly across the screen. By disabling this effect, you can reduce the amount of processing power required to render images, resulting in higher FPS.

What is the best resolution for Overwatch 2?

Best Overwatch 2 PC settings
  • Display Mode: Fullscreen.
  • Resolution: This should be the native resolution of your PC in System Settings e.g 2560×1440.
  • Field of View: 103.
  • Aspect Ratio: Your monitor's aspect ratio e.g 16:9.
  • Dynamic Render Scale: Off.
  • Render Scale: Custom. In-game Resolution: 100%
  • Frame Rate: Custom. ...
  • V-Sync: Off.

Is motion blur bad for gaming?

Motion blur is useful on consoles and slow computers which can't run games at a decent FPS - it makes motion appear less choppy. It should never be used if you can run the game properly, though.

How much RAM should Overwatch 2 use?

RAM: 6 GB RAM. Storage: 50 GB of free space available. Graphics card: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 660 or AMD Radeon HD 7950 or higher. Screen resolution: minimum 1024 x 768.
